    I like the idea... There's some room for improvement though. Using your current method, you can set a static local IP for the ESP in the Sketch. If the ESP doesn't "choose" its own local IP it is assigned an IP by the DHCP Server of the router. Due to this "negotiation" the ESP needs a little longer to connect. If you really want to save time there are other methods, some of which involve more "hacks" than others. Personally I think the best method is to have one "main ESP" somewhere in the house that receives ESP now packets and relays them into the wifi network somehow. It's a bit tricky since you can have ESP now and wifi at the same time. But there are solutions. Anyway the main ESP can be considered the "ESP now" gateway. And then any device that has limited power just wakes up and sends an ESP now message to that gateway. This has the advantage the ESP hast to be awake for less than 50 ms compared to a few seconds when it connects to wifi normally.
    P.S. After the rectifier you don't have 12 V DC... 12 V AC is the RMS voltage (Effektivspannung), when rectified you get the peak voltage which is 12 V * sqrt(2) = 17 V minus the voltage drop over the rectifier of about 1.4 V... So probably around 15.5 V. Also the transformer is most likely not regulated therefore is around 12 V AC under a specific load. Personally I would assume a max voltage of 25 V or so to be on the safe side.
    And anther thing to consider, is that while buck converters are more efficient, they usually have a higher quiescent current. So while the ESP sends the message it is more efficient. But when it sleeps, you would probably be better off using a linear voltage regulator with a low quiescent current. This is especially important with battery powered projects that deep sleep most of the time.

    Aren't 16V capacitors for the energy storage rated too low in voltage? IIRC 12V AC RMS is ~12*sqrt(2) = 17V peak. The full bridge rectifier will take 1-2V so then you'll just be in spec, but I wouldn't feel comfortable with so little headroom. Unless I'm mistaken of course.
    Edit: from the charging time the RC time seems sth like 300 ms, so similar to the 6 Ohm resistor you proposed. If someone were to press the bell for longer than 5 RC time constants (1.5 s) angry people at your door could make capacitors explode :).

Setting a static IP will help, but setting the BSSID and WiFi Channel Number for your access point will make an ever bigger difference and speed up connection even further, because then the ESP won't need to sit there and scan channels and wait for announcement frames! Channel and BSSID are parameters #3 and #4 on WiFi.begin().

    Since you effectively can have power at both the doorbell push button and the bell you could permanently power an 8266 in the doorbell. If you simply tap across the doorbell push button you would need either a small battery or capacitors to maintain charge when the push button is pushed. This way the 8266 stays live and attached to WiFi and response times are drastically reduced. You can then also use an MQTT client in the 8266. Alternatively if you wire the push button to the 8266 instead then you have more control over your doorbell like turning it off overnight. Using a relay with the 8266 you can have it also monitor MQTT and ring the bell. An alternative to the relay is to use another 8266 in the bell box to trigger the sounder. Deriving power for this 8266 is a little harder and getting enough to trigger the solenoid is also more challenging but this lets you add say an infrared sensor outside so you can also activate the sounder if someone approaches the door and just knocks. It is potentially easier to replace the chime with a small mp3/ogg player, amp and speaker then you have a choice of chimes and its easier to power.

      I will try this as well, i recently analyzed power draw of different rf methods on the esp32. WiFi takes up to 3s (and 858mWs) from wakeup to successful transmit, LoRa (868MHz) takes just 500ms (69mWs) and ESP-NOW is also a great way, it only takes 640ms (108,9mAs).
